excel中now()什么意思
作者:excel百科网
|
163人看过
发布时间:2026-01-16 22:55:23
标签:
Excel中NOW()函数到底是什么?Excel是一个广泛应用于办公场景的电子表格软件,它不仅可以进行数据计算,还能实现数据的自动化处理。在Excel中,函数是实现自动化操作的核心工具之一。而其中,NOW()函数是一个非常实用的
Excel中NOW()函数到底是什么?
Excel是一个广泛应用于办公场景的电子表格软件,它不仅可以进行数据计算,还能实现数据的自动化处理。在Excel中,函数是实现自动化操作的核心工具之一。而其中,NOW()函数是一个非常实用的函数,它能够帮助用户快速获取当前的时间信息。本文将从NOW()函数的定义、使用方法、功能特点、应用场景等方面,深入解析其在Excel中的实际应用。
一、NOW()函数的基本定义
NOW()函数是Excel中一个用于获取当前日期和时间的函数。它返回的是Excel工作表当前的日期和时间,包括年、月、日、时、分、秒等信息。该函数在Excel中是一个动态函数,意味着它会随着工作表的自动更新而实时变化。
在Excel中,NOW()函数的语法如下:
NOW()
该函数返回的值是当前日期和时间,例如:2025-03-12 14:30:00。在使用时,用户可以根据需要对这个时间值进行格式化处理,以满足不同的应用场景。
二、NOW()函数的使用方法
1. 直接使用
在Excel的单元格中输入公式 `=NOW()`,即可直接获取当前的日期和时间。这一操作非常简单,适合快速获取时间信息。
2. 与格式化函数结合使用
为了更直观地显示时间,用户可以结合Excel的日期格式化函数(如TEXT函数)来调整NOW()返回的格式。例如:
=TEXT(NOW(),"yyyy-mm-dd hh:mm:ss")
该公式将NOW()返回的时间转换为“yyyy-mm-dd hh:mm:ss”的格式,便于查看和记录。
3. 与VBA结合使用
在VBA(Visual Basic for Applications)中,NOW()函数可以用于获取当前时间并赋值给变量。这种使用方式在自动化操作或程序开发中非常常见。
三、NOW()函数的功能特点
1. 动态更新
NOW()函数是一个动态函数,它会随着Excel工作表的自动更新而实时变化。这意味着,当工作表中的数据发生变化时,NOW()的值也会随之更新,确保时间信息始终准确无误。
2. 不受系统时间影响
与某些其他函数不同,NOW()函数不会受到系统时间设置的影响。无论用户设置的是哪种时区,NOW()都会返回当前的日期和时间,确保数据的一致性。
3. 与日期函数的结合使用
NOW()函数常与日期函数(如TODAY()、DATE()、TIME()等)结合使用,以实现更复杂的日期和时间计算。例如:
- `TODAY()`:返回当前日期,不包含时间。
- `TIME(2,30,15)`:返回一个时间值,格式为“hh:mm:ss”。
通过这些函数的组合使用,用户可以更灵活地处理日期和时间信息。
四、NOW()函数的常见应用场景
1. 记录操作时间
在Excel中,用户常常需要记录某个操作的时间,如数据录入、报表生成等。NOW()函数可以方便地实现这一需求。
示例:
在Excel中,用户可以将NOW()函数作为时间戳,记录操作时间:
=A1: 2025-03-12 14:30:00
=B1: 2025-03-12 14:31:00
=C1: =NOW()
在C1单元格中输入公式 `=NOW()`,即可实时显示当前时间。
2. 自动化报表生成
在报表生成过程中,用户常常需要根据时间信息来筛选数据或进行排序。NOW()函数可以帮助用户快速生成时间相关的报表。
示例:
用户可以使用NOW()函数来筛选昨天的数据,例如:
=IF(NOW() > DATE(2025,3,12), "显示", "隐藏")
该公式将根据当前时间判断是否在2025年3月12日之前,从而控制数据的显示与隐藏。
3. 定时任务与数据记录
在Excel中,用户可以利用NOW()函数实现定时任务,例如自动记录数据的录入时间。这在数据自动化处理中非常有用。
五、NOW()函数的局限性与注意事项
1. 不适用于时间计算
虽然NOW()函数可以返回当前时间,但它并非用于时间计算的函数。如果用户需要进行时间差、时间加减等操作,应使用其他函数,如DATEDIF、HOUR、MINUTE等。
2. 与系统时间同步问题
在某些情况下,用户可能会遇到NOW()函数返回的时间与系统时间不一致的问题。这通常与系统时间设置或Excel版本有关,用户应确保系统时间设置正确。
3. 不支持时区转换
由于NOW()函数返回的是系统时间,它无法自动转换为其他时区的时间。如果需要处理时区问题,用户应使用其他函数或工具来实现时区转换。
六、NOW()函数与其他时间函数的对比
为了更好地理解NOW()函数的作用,我们可以对比它与其他时间函数的使用方式。
| 函数名称 | 功能描述 | 使用场景 |
|-|-|-|
| NOW() | 返回当前日期和时间 | 实时记录时间 |
| TODAY() | 返回当前日期 | 比较日期 |
| DATE() | 创建特定日期 | 日期计算 |
| TIME() | 创建特定时间 | 时间计算 |
| HOURS() | 获取当前小时 | 时间计算 |
| MINUTES()| 获取当前分钟 | 时间计算 |
这些函数在不同的应用场景中各有优势,用户可以根据具体需求选择合适的函数。
七、实际案例分析
案例1:记录数据录入时间
在Excel中,用户可以使用NOW()函数来记录数据录入的时间,确保数据的可追溯性。
操作步骤:
1. 在Excel中创建一个表格,用于记录数据录入时间。
2. 在表格中,输入公式 `=NOW()`,并将其放置在数据录入时间的单元格中。
3. 每次录入数据后,更新该单元格的值,即可记录当前时间。
案例2:生成时间戳
在数据处理过程中,用户可以使用NOW()函数生成时间戳,用于后续的数据分析。
操作步骤:
1. 在Excel中创建一个列,用于存储时间戳。
2. 在该列中输入公式 `=TEXT(NOW(),"yyyy-mm-dd hh:mm:ss")`。
3. 该公式将NOW()返回的时间格式化为“yyyy-mm-dd hh:mm:ss”的形式,便于查看和分析。
八、总结
Excel中的NOW()函数是一个非常实用的工具,它能够帮助用户快速获取当前的日期和时间,并且具有动态更新、不受系统时间影响等优点。在实际应用中,用户可以根据具体需求,结合其他函数和公式,实现更复杂的日期和时间处理。通过合理使用NOW()函数,用户可以提高工作效率,确保数据的准确性和一致性。
在未来,随着Excel功能的不断升级,NOW()函数将继续扮演重要角色。掌握这一函数的使用,是提升Excel操作水平的关键之一。
Excel是一个广泛应用于办公场景的电子表格软件,它不仅可以进行数据计算,还能实现数据的自动化处理。在Excel中,函数是实现自动化操作的核心工具之一。而其中,NOW()函数是一个非常实用的函数,它能够帮助用户快速获取当前的时间信息。本文将从NOW()函数的定义、使用方法、功能特点、应用场景等方面,深入解析其在Excel中的实际应用。
一、NOW()函数的基本定义
NOW()函数是Excel中一个用于获取当前日期和时间的函数。它返回的是Excel工作表当前的日期和时间,包括年、月、日、时、分、秒等信息。该函数在Excel中是一个动态函数,意味着它会随着工作表的自动更新而实时变化。
在Excel中,NOW()函数的语法如下:
NOW()
该函数返回的值是当前日期和时间,例如:2025-03-12 14:30:00。在使用时,用户可以根据需要对这个时间值进行格式化处理,以满足不同的应用场景。
二、NOW()函数的使用方法
1. 直接使用
在Excel的单元格中输入公式 `=NOW()`,即可直接获取当前的日期和时间。这一操作非常简单,适合快速获取时间信息。
2. 与格式化函数结合使用
为了更直观地显示时间,用户可以结合Excel的日期格式化函数(如TEXT函数)来调整NOW()返回的格式。例如:
=TEXT(NOW(),"yyyy-mm-dd hh:mm:ss")
该公式将NOW()返回的时间转换为“yyyy-mm-dd hh:mm:ss”的格式,便于查看和记录。
3. 与VBA结合使用
在VBA(Visual Basic for Applications)中,NOW()函数可以用于获取当前时间并赋值给变量。这种使用方式在自动化操作或程序开发中非常常见。
三、NOW()函数的功能特点
1. 动态更新
NOW()函数是一个动态函数,它会随着Excel工作表的自动更新而实时变化。这意味着,当工作表中的数据发生变化时,NOW()的值也会随之更新,确保时间信息始终准确无误。
2. 不受系统时间影响
与某些其他函数不同,NOW()函数不会受到系统时间设置的影响。无论用户设置的是哪种时区,NOW()都会返回当前的日期和时间,确保数据的一致性。
3. 与日期函数的结合使用
NOW()函数常与日期函数(如TODAY()、DATE()、TIME()等)结合使用,以实现更复杂的日期和时间计算。例如:
- `TODAY()`:返回当前日期,不包含时间。
- `TIME(2,30,15)`:返回一个时间值,格式为“hh:mm:ss”。
通过这些函数的组合使用,用户可以更灵活地处理日期和时间信息。
四、NOW()函数的常见应用场景
1. 记录操作时间
在Excel中,用户常常需要记录某个操作的时间,如数据录入、报表生成等。NOW()函数可以方便地实现这一需求。
示例:
在Excel中,用户可以将NOW()函数作为时间戳,记录操作时间:
=A1: 2025-03-12 14:30:00
=B1: 2025-03-12 14:31:00
=C1: =NOW()
在C1单元格中输入公式 `=NOW()`,即可实时显示当前时间。
2. 自动化报表生成
在报表生成过程中,用户常常需要根据时间信息来筛选数据或进行排序。NOW()函数可以帮助用户快速生成时间相关的报表。
示例:
用户可以使用NOW()函数来筛选昨天的数据,例如:
=IF(NOW() > DATE(2025,3,12), "显示", "隐藏")
该公式将根据当前时间判断是否在2025年3月12日之前,从而控制数据的显示与隐藏。
3. 定时任务与数据记录
在Excel中,用户可以利用NOW()函数实现定时任务,例如自动记录数据的录入时间。这在数据自动化处理中非常有用。
五、NOW()函数的局限性与注意事项
1. 不适用于时间计算
虽然NOW()函数可以返回当前时间,但它并非用于时间计算的函数。如果用户需要进行时间差、时间加减等操作,应使用其他函数,如DATEDIF、HOUR、MINUTE等。
2. 与系统时间同步问题
在某些情况下,用户可能会遇到NOW()函数返回的时间与系统时间不一致的问题。这通常与系统时间设置或Excel版本有关,用户应确保系统时间设置正确。
3. 不支持时区转换
由于NOW()函数返回的是系统时间,它无法自动转换为其他时区的时间。如果需要处理时区问题,用户应使用其他函数或工具来实现时区转换。
六、NOW()函数与其他时间函数的对比
为了更好地理解NOW()函数的作用,我们可以对比它与其他时间函数的使用方式。
| 函数名称 | 功能描述 | 使用场景 |
|-|-|-|
| NOW() | 返回当前日期和时间 | 实时记录时间 |
| TODAY() | 返回当前日期 | 比较日期 |
| DATE() | 创建特定日期 | 日期计算 |
| TIME() | 创建特定时间 | 时间计算 |
| HOURS() | 获取当前小时 | 时间计算 |
| MINUTES()| 获取当前分钟 | 时间计算 |
这些函数在不同的应用场景中各有优势,用户可以根据具体需求选择合适的函数。
七、实际案例分析
案例1:记录数据录入时间
在Excel中,用户可以使用NOW()函数来记录数据录入的时间,确保数据的可追溯性。
操作步骤:
1. 在Excel中创建一个表格,用于记录数据录入时间。
2. 在表格中,输入公式 `=NOW()`,并将其放置在数据录入时间的单元格中。
3. 每次录入数据后,更新该单元格的值,即可记录当前时间。
案例2:生成时间戳
在数据处理过程中,用户可以使用NOW()函数生成时间戳,用于后续的数据分析。
操作步骤:
1. 在Excel中创建一个列,用于存储时间戳。
2. 在该列中输入公式 `=TEXT(NOW(),"yyyy-mm-dd hh:mm:ss")`。
3. 该公式将NOW()返回的时间格式化为“yyyy-mm-dd hh:mm:ss”的形式,便于查看和分析。
八、总结
Excel中的NOW()函数是一个非常实用的工具,它能够帮助用户快速获取当前的日期和时间,并且具有动态更新、不受系统时间影响等优点。在实际应用中,用户可以根据具体需求,结合其他函数和公式,实现更复杂的日期和时间处理。通过合理使用NOW()函数,用户可以提高工作效率,确保数据的准确性和一致性。
在未来,随着Excel功能的不断升级,NOW()函数将继续扮演重要角色。掌握这一函数的使用,是提升Excel操作水平的关键之一。
推荐文章
为什么Excel编辑栏变灰?深度解析与实用建议Excel作为一款广泛使用的电子表格软件,其用户界面的正常运行对于工作效率至关重要。其中,编辑栏(Edit Bar)是Excel界面中一个至关重要的组成部分,它位于工作表的顶部,用
2026-01-16 22:54:40
152人看过
Excel序列设置用什么符号隔开:深度解析与实用指南在Excel中,数据的排列与处理常常需要借助序列功能,例如日期序列、数字序列、文本序列等。这些序列的设置通常依赖于特定的符号来隔开不同的数据项或单元格内容。本文将深入探讨Excel中
2026-01-16 22:54:21
179人看过
Excel表格自动关闭的原因详解Excel表格在使用过程中,有时会突然自动关闭,这给用户带来了诸多不便。自动关闭的原因多种多样,本文将从多个角度深入分析,帮助用户理解Excel自动关闭的常见原因,并提供实用的解决方法。 一、E
2026-01-16 22:52:56
376人看过
为什么Excel出现不了小加号在日常办公和数据分析中,Excel是一个不可或缺的工具。它以其强大的数据处理能力、灵活的公式功能和丰富的图表功能,被广泛应用于企业、学校、科研机构等各类场景。然而,对于许多用户来说,一个看似简单的功能——
2026-01-16 22:52:54
189人看过

.webp)
